I added 2 spst relays, one was for the injector live feed, but I can't remember off the top of my head what the second was, it was simply done due to the differences in the looms as not every sr engine loom wire has a matching wire on the n16 interior loom and a coupel of them were switched live feeds, so instead of piggybacking them off of another switched live I fitted relays, I put them behind the passenger side kick panel using the same bracket that's used at the drivers side kick panel for the fuel pump relay.

right im a complete noob with wiring , i have three wire's that need to go to ign live would it be ok goin straight from the fuse box into another aftermarket fusebox? another thing when i turn the ignition on the fuel pump primes for about 1 second then stop's. is there a fuel pump relay in the circuit or do i have to put one in ? also when i connect the dizzy +ve to ign live i get a mil light , it cranks, fuel is getting in the plugs are wet but it will not fire. is there something ive missed out
 
yes it will be fine, but you'd be as well running a line from the 60amp main fuse from the fusebox next to the battery, and run it in along the engine loom into the passenger footwell. what 3 switched lives do you have to hook up, two of them will be the ones I put relays in for, the coil/dizzy live and the injector live, what's the third?

the fuel pump should only go for a second or so to prime/build pressure.

do you have a spark when cranking? is your nats all hooked up and working correctly?
